A STUDENT from York has been awarded a BAFTA scholarship to fund her MA studies in computer animation at Bournemouth University.
Emily Ellis, 26, said she felt completely overwhelmed by the support of the BAFTA panel and its belief in her creative abilities after being told she will receive £7,500.
Emily will also be mentored by BAFTA members, award-winners and nominees, and be given free access to BAFTA events.
She said: “This incredible scholarship will support a life affirming journey into realising my creative dreams and potential, as well as offering industry mentoring and the chance to contribute through BAFTA Guru, an unimaginable opportunity I wouldn’t have had otherwise.”
